UNITARY CONTROL DEVICE OF AUTOMATIC SPEED CHANGE GEAR AND ENGINE

PURPOSE:To prevent the generation of misfire, by controlling the variation of engine torque when the terminal voltage of the battery drops below a specific value, in the system where the speed change property is kept in a good condition by converting the engine torque only at a specific value in a speed change operation. AUTOMATIC TRANSMISSION

PURPOSE:To prevent a vehicle from inadvertently rushing out, by providing such an arrangement that an accelerator pedal is depressed in a condition in which the pressure of air fed into an actuator is lower than an operating pressure, and the vehicle is inhibited from starting in this condition even if the pressure of air increases up to the operating operation. AUTOMATIC TRANSMISSION

PURPOSE:To make it possible to manually shift an automatic transmission into a start gear position upon emergency, by attaching a lever to the control shaft of the transmission, and by connecting a plurality of control cables to the lever so that the control shaft may be slid in the rotating and axial directions. DIFFERENTIAL GEARING DEVICE

PURPOSE:To hinder mist etc. of lubricant from splashing outside by furnishing a shelter to block the gap between a pair of large gears throughout the periphery of large gears. CONSTITUTION:While a pair of wheels 14, 15 rotate at the same speed, a movable member 31 constituting a shelter is energized by a spring 34 in the direction protruding from an accommodation part 29. COATING MATERIAL HAVING ANTI-ADHERENT EXTERNAL SURFACE

A protective composition which comprises at least one aliphatic polyisocyanate, at least one aromatic polyisocyanate and a solvent.

MOBILE ROBOT CALLING SYSTEM

A mobile robot calling system has a mobile robot normally waiting at a home position and connected to an AC power supply such that its battery is charged by the AC power supply in the wait status, and a calling oscillator for generating a calling signal to the mobile robot.
